you cant use anything but design studio on your cricut even if you found the old scal, your new cricut has already been updated not to be able to use it, only the older cricuts can as long as they havent been updated. My advice to you is to sell your cricut and buy a different cutter if you are wanting to create your own designs without the use of buying cartridges. provo craft has made cricut a scrapbooking device only for use with their things ( and are way over priced by the way), when you buy a silhouette, eclips, or any other plotter they can be used for anything.
